Output 6c59cd35fb8602dcb6298576a922114491e73b7ee95190ac9728de461f13305e:0

value
3620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ac610576e5d81d1cd4666ec399cfb83f0bd5ee9b OP_EQUAL
address
3HQUNhYYy8mgGY9D7LE2ZjMjx12vELxRMZ
transaction
6c59cd35fb8602dcb6298576a922114491e73b7ee95190ac9728de461f13305e
spent
true